25 May 2005 Simulation of wave structure function through atmospheric propagation

Abstract
While the wave structure function has been analytically calculated for a variety of beam types, recent work has begun the exploration of higher-order beams and partially coherent beams. For these waves, no analytic wave structure function has been developed. By extending the well known split step phase screen simulations, we have developed a method of numerically simulating the wave structure function. We present the methods and results of this simulation technique, and describe its applicability to general beams.
